Aneto

The Aneto (in Catalan and Gascon Occitan peak of Aneto , in Aragonese Pico Aneto , in Spanish Aneto ) is the culminating point of the the Pyrenees with 3.404 Mr. It is located in Spain in the Province of Huesca, in the north of the Aragon. It belongs to the Massif of Maladeta whose it constitutes the southern end.

Its old French name was the Néthou , but it fell in disuse to the profit from that from Aneto, or peak of Aneto .

Its rise is generally carried out starting from the large refuge of Rencluse located at 2140 meters of altitude. The route crosses, in its bigger length, the Glacier of Aneto which extends to north from the peak.

The top is defended by a very short rock passage: the No Mahomet . It is a short edge of large stable blocks, not very broad and open on a vacuum impressing on each side. Attention, possible obstruction!

At the top one can admire an impressive cross and discover a contrasted sight, the Massif of snow-covered Maladeta in north and dark and dry Haut-Aragon in the south.

  • 1842 - on July 18th, Plato de Tchihatcheff , Russian officer who rests with Luchon, his guide Pierre Sanio de Luz, the guides Luchonnais Bernard Arrazau and Pierre Redonnet, Albert de Franqueville, a Norman botanist, and his Jean guide Sors, start from Bagnères-with-Luchon. They take the way of the old people's home of France, cross the Port of Vénasque and spend the night safe from Rencluse, then simple dry stone construction. The following day, they manage to cross a collar, towards the collar of Alba and are lost on the Southern slope towards the Lake Gregueña. The evening, with end of force, they find refuge in a hut towards the valley of Malibierne. At daybreak, after a short night of rest, here are left again towards the collar Coroné. In spite of the fear of the cracks, they decide to try the top by the glacier. After the passage of a frayed edge of a few tens of meters which will give them difficulties (Albert de Franqueville will baptize this passage “Bridge of Mahomet”) here on the top. A Cairn is set up and a bottle containing the name of the first mountaineers is left at the top. The culminating point of the Pyrenees is overcome on July 20th, 1842.
  • 1879 - on March 1st, Roger de Monts, B. Courrèges, B. and V. Paget make it first winter rise of it.
